What is a Copy Paper Box?
A copy paper box is a storage container designed to hold basic reams of Budget-Friendly Copy Paper paper. These boxes are normally made from cardboard and are built to be tough sufficient to safeguard the paper from damage, moisture, and dirt. The majority of commonly, a copy paper box contains 500 sheets of paper, though this can vary depending upon the maker and kind of paper.

Picking the right copy paper box might not look like a considerable choice, but it can make a big distinction in your workflow and total efficiency. Here are some essential factors to think about:
1. Size
The size of the copy paper box need to match the kind of paper you mean to use. Many basic boxes fit 8.5 x 11 inches or A4 Copy Paper Stock sheets, however if you require other sizes, look for specialized boxes.
2. Weight
The weight of the paper affects its resilience and suitability for different tasks. Standard paper weighs about 20 pound, while much heavier choices might weigh 24 pound or more. Choose a weight that aligns with your printing requires.
3. Type of Paper
Consider whether you require standard white paper, colored choices, or specialty sheets. Different jobs require various types of paper to achieve the desired result.
4. Storage and Organization
If you have actually restricted storage space, think about stackable boxes or those with a slim profile. An organized office is vital for workflow performance.
5. Environmental Impact
Try to find eco-friendly choices that utilize recycled materials or have certifications like the Forest Stewardship Council (FSC). Sustainable options assist lower your environmental footprint.

Proper storage of copy paper boxes can assist keep the quality of the paper and lengthen its lifespan. Here are some storage suggestions:
